Output 8b15aba41f98d201610cbf21f093f8e5c25caa5f23138662089fe06f0452423f:85

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1596f7b9d1e712cd8c430f59ac239e4cfbfd8a6688ee6897f828734a69e09753
address
bc1pzkt00ww3uufvmrzrpav6cgu7fnalmznx3rhx39lc9pe5560qjafs0c2xfh
transaction
8b15aba41f98d201610cbf21f093f8e5c25caa5f23138662089fe06f0452423f
spent
true